    Hi, great looking video. Man I have the Zve1 and I just got the7artisans adapter to be able to use my 18-35, but when I turn on the active stabilization The footage becomes very shaky, I also have the sigma 24-70, and works good on this, but can’t get it to work with the 18-35, I am wondering if I should change any setting for this, any thoughts?     Yes. For some reason when adapting lenses electronically the focal length information is not passed to the camera correctly. I’m sure it’s done on purpose tbh because it works fine in photo mode. You need to go to stabilisation settings and turn of automatic focal length Aquisition. Not sure what it’s actually called. After that you can adjust the focal length to what you’re currently using for best result. I used a custom button to bring the focal length list. In case of this particular lens you can just set the focal length of stabilisation to 24mm and it should give you decent results in all focal lengths. Bizarrely I’ve had the Sigma 28-70 f2.8, e mount native lens and I had to do the same exact thing when using this lens as the ibis was going absolute nuts. Neither Sony nor sigma where of any help.
